Shell buys into 190 mln boe Cluff gas projects in UK North Sea

Royal Dutch Shell bought stakes and options in gas licenses in the southern British North Sea estimated to contain a total of 190 million barrels of oil equivalent from Cluff Natural Resources, Cluff said on Friday

NOVATEK discovers Nyakhartinskoye field

NOVATEK announced that its wholly owned subsidiary NOVATEK-Yurkharovneftegas, upon testing of the exploration well PO-1 achieved commercial flows of natural gas from the Lower Cretaceous sediments at the Nyakhartinskiy license area with a gas condensate mixture well flow rate of more than 300 thousand m3 per day.

BW Offshore begins oil production from Tortue field offshore Gabon

BW Offshore and Panoro Energy have reported first oil production from the Tortue field in the Dussafu license offshore Gabon, using the BW Adolo floating production storage and offloading (FPSO) vessel.

Aker BP to acquire Total’s Norway offshore acreage for $205m

Aker BP has signed a deal to acquire Total E&P Norge’s stakes in a portfolio of licenses located on the Norwegian Continental Shelf for a total of $205m.

Siemens Gamesa offers a license for an 8MW wind turbine technology to Shanghai Electric

Siemens Gamesa Renewable Energy (SGRE) has inked an additional licensing accord with its partner Shanghai Electric for the 8MW Direct Drive technology to enhance its offshore strategy in China.
